无法让 Ubuntu 安装 UEFI

无法让 Ubuntu 安装 UEFI

我已经忙了一整天了。我运行的是 Windows 7,想安装 ubuntu,但就是不行。我关闭了安全驱动器。我可以正常启动 USB,但每次我尝试使用启动修复时,都会出现“此启动是旧版...”的提示,如果我在 uefi 中启动,它只会转到 Windows。我使用 yumi 创建磁盘,并尝试使用 ubuntu 磁盘写入创建它。我不知道我错过了什么。

答案1

我建议使用 创建启动盘dd,如下所示:

dd if=image.iso of=/dev/sdc

更改image.iso为您要写入的文件名和/dev/sdcUSB 闪存驱动器的设备文件名。第三方磁盘映像工具可能会也可能不会创建可在 EFI 模式下启动的磁盘映像。也就是说,有些罕见的计算机需要使用这样的第三方工具来准备可启动的 USB 驱动器;但在这些情况下,您必须确保该工具能够创建可启动的 EFI 映像。我上次检查时,YUMI 确实不是可以解决这个问题。我不太清楚 Ubuntu 启动盘创建器是否能解决这个问题。可以创建 EFI 可启动盘的工具通常需要明确设置 EFI 兼容性选项。

创建映像后,您可能需要使用固件的内置启动管理器来启动它。这通常是通过功能键访问的,但具体哪个功能键因机器而异(有些机器使用完全不同的键,如 Esc 或 Enter)。如果驱动器可以在 BIOS/CSM/传统模式和 EFI/UEFI 模式下启动,则启动管理器中通常会有两个磁盘条目。要在 EFI/UEFI 模式下启动,请选择描述中包含“UEFI”的条目。没有描述中的“UEFI”启动到 BIOS/CSM/传统模式。

您可以通过查找名为 的目录来检查您的启动模式/sys/firmware/efi;如果该目录存在,则表示您已在 EFI/UEFI 模式下启动。如果不存在,则您可能已在 BIOS/CSM/legacy 模式下启动。

答案2

我花了很长时间才弄清楚,但我找到了一些可行的方法。我在运行 Windows 8 的 Toshiba Sattelite e45t-A4200 上安装了两次 Ubuntu。
方法如下:

  1. 进入 BIOS 并将启动从 UEFI 更改为 CSM(我的处于高级状态),将启动优先级首先更改为 USB,并禁用安全启动。

  2. 使用 USB 磁盘启动机器。

  3. 使用 USB 磁盘安装 Ubuntu(在 CSM 模式下)。这次不用理会“安装时下载更新”。

  4. 重启机器时进入 BIOS。如果您的计算机有 HDD 和 SSD,请将 HDD 设为第一个。另外,将启动模式改回 UEFI。

  5. 使用 USB 驱动器重新启动机器。

  6. 使用 USB 磁盘重新安装 Ubuntu(在 UEFI 中)。

  7. 最后一次从 USB 驱动器重新启动机器。

  8. 从 USB 驱动器运行启动修复。

免责声明 我使用这种方法替换了 Windows。我不知道它是否适用于并排安装。对于并排安装,我知道它是有效的。

我希望这有帮助!

-乔希

答案3

我最近不得不重新安装,不得不重新解决这个问题。我以前的解决方案不起作用。以下是我对 UEFI 安装的一些想法,这些想法使它(正常工作)工作。

我使用 USB 启动盘进行启动。若要在 UEFI 中启动,启动盘必须格式化为 FAT32 才能启动。

无论出于什么原因,我必须在 BIOS 中“恢复默认值”才能使启动棒正常工作。

安装完成后,我必须再次从 USB 启动并运行“启动修复”才能使安装正常工作。此后没有问题。我希望这会有所帮助,并且我认为这是使用 UEFI 安装的更好/更简单的方法。

相关内容